Its biggest drawback is that it only works on Windows. ![]() Here’s a very simple orchestral VST that puts an entire orchestra at your fingertips. The One Track Visual Orchestra is quite literally an orchestral VST that’ll only take up one track in your DAW. The caveat here is that you’ll need a pretty big MIDI keyboard since the orchestra is sectioned into different MIDI key ranges. Still, as a tool for quick inspiration or for finding arrangement ideas, this could be a great orchestral VST for your plugins folder. Sonatina is a classic MIDI orchestra plugin with a lot of capability, especially for making traditional orchestral arrangements. The free plugin comes with full sections across the spectrum of orchestral instruments including strings, brass, woodwinds, keys, choir and percussion. The library of samples are meticulously recorded and makes a great option for use as a fairly serious tool for orchestral composition. You even get a handful of effects for controlling stage and room ambiance. Overall, for composition tasks that demand standard orchestral arrangements, this is a great option.
